Our goal is to structure a transaction that provides you with money from the sale whenever the property's value, mortgage, liens, closing costs, and other expenses make that possible.
The exact amount you receive depends on your specific situation and the terms of the transaction.
If equity is available after accounting for the property's obligations and transaction costs, we will work to put as much cash as reasonably possible in your hands.
When we purchase a property, we have to consider the costs involved in acquiring, repairing, holding, and eventually using or selling the property.
Because of these costs and risks, our purchase price may be below the property's retail market value. However, depending on your situation, we may be able to provide a simpler and faster solution than a traditional sale.
